Pirelli still wait for FIA to rubber stamp 2017 deal

Pirelli are now waiting for the FIA to formalise and rubber stamp the new deal to keep supplying tyres exclusively to Formula 1 teams beyond 2016. As they symbolically shook hands on the Sochi grid last Sunday, Bernie Ecclestone and Pirelli CEO Marco Tronchetti Provera revealed that they have agreed terms over a new three-year contract until 2019. Curiously, however, the usual celebratory press announcements from both Formula One Management (FOM) and the Italian tyre company have been lacking, even though Pirelli's F1 chief Paul Hembery said he was 'delighted' with the deal.
